Trusted WordPress tutorials, when you need them most.
Beginner’s Guide to WordPress
Copa WPB
25 Million+
Websites using our plugins
16+
Years of WordPress experience
3000+
WordPress tutorials
by experts

Cómo instalar plugins y temas de WordPress desde GitHub

Aunque la mayoría de los usuarios suelen instalar plugins y temas de WordPress directamente desde el repositorio de WordPress.org, también hay muchas otras opciones en GitHub.

GitHub es un servicio de alojamiento de proyectos utilizado por muchos proyectos y desarrolladores de código abierto. Como usuario de WordPress, a veces puedes encontrarte con plugins o temas alojados en GitHub.

Dado que GitHub no es específico para el desarrollo de WordPress, puede resultar difícil para un nuevo usuario averiguar cómo descargar e instalar un plugin o un tema desde esta plataforma.

Hemos trabajado con un montón de diferentes plugins de GitHub antes, así que sabemos todo lo que se necesita para configurarlos en su sitio web de WordPress y mantenerlos actualizados.

Y en este artículo, te mostraremos cómo instalar plugins o temas de WordPress desde GitHub.

Installing a WordPress plugin or theme from GitHub

¿Qué es GitHub?

Como ya hemos mencionado, GitHub es un servicio de alojamiento de código. Su uso es gratuito para proyectos de código abierto y, en la actualidad, es el servicio de alojamiento de proyectos más popular entre los desarrolladores de código abierto.

Utiliza el sistema de control de revisiones Git, de ahí el nombre de GitHub. No sólo eso, sino que proporciona herramientas sencillas de colaboración y funciones de red social, como seguir a usuarios, dar estrellas a repositorios, suscribirse a repositorios y proyectos, etc.

GitHub puede utilizarse en cualquier proyecto que desee utilizar las funciones de control de revisiones de Git. Por ejemplo, puede utilizarse para recursos de aprendizaje de código abierto, proyectos de documentación, manuales, guías, etc. Las herramientas de GitHub permiten a los usuarios añadir a otros usuarios a sus proyectos y trabajar con ellos en equipo.

Dicho esto, veamos cómo instalar plugins y temas de WordPress desde GitHub.

Cómo instalar plugins y temas de WordPress desde GitHub

Antes de instalar un tema o plugin de WordPress desde GitHub, asegúrate de que puedes recibir sus actualizaciones. Cubriremos esa parte más adelante en este artículo.

Instalar plugins y temas desde GitHub es muy fácil. Es como instalar un plugin de WordPress manualmente.

En primer lugar, tienes que ir al repositorio del plugin/tema en GitHub.

En la página principal del repositorio, haga clic en el botón “Código” y seleccione “Descargar ZIP”.

GitHub download zip

Ahora, diríjase a su área de administrador de WordPress y vaya a la página Plugins ” Añadir nuevo.

Tendrás que subir manualmente el plugin desde tu ordenador. Para ello, haga clic en el botón “Subir plugin”.

Manually upload and install a WordPress plugin

Esto le mostrará la opción de subir el archivo zip del plugin.

Tienes que hacer clic en el botón “Elegir archivo” y, a continuación, seleccionar el archivo ZIP de tu ordenador.

A continuación, debes hacer clic en el botón “Instalar ahora”. WordPress subirá el archivo zip desde su ordenador a su sitio web, lo descomprimirá e instalará el plugin.

Una vez hecho esto, verá un mensaje de correcto. A continuación, puede hacer clic en “Activar” para activar el plugin en su sitio web de WordPress.

Cómo obtener actualizaciones para plugins de WordPress instalados desde GitHub

Por defecto, WordPress busca una versión más reciente del plugin basándose en el archivo read me del plugin y en la cabecera del plugin, que contiene la información sobre la última versión estable a usar.

Sin embargo, por defecto, WordPress no muestra actualizaciones automáticas para plugins descargados de GitHub. Para activar que los usuarios reciban automáticamente las actualizaciones directamente desde los repositorios de GitHub, los desarrolladores de temas y plugins tienen que hacer un pequeño esfuerzo adicional.

Para ello, es posible que algunos plugins y temas de GitHub ya hayan incluido el código que le permitirá recibir actualizaciones automáticas.

En algunos casos, el desarrollador del tema/plugin puede pedirte que instales el plugin GitHub Updater. Esto te permitirá obtener actualizaciones de los plugins y temas de GitHub.

En cualquier caso, tendrás que ponerte en contacto con el desarrollador del plugin/tema en GitHub y preguntarle acerca de la situación de las actualizaciones para estar seguro de que recibirás actualizaciones cuando publiquen una nueva versión.

Bonificación: Cómo implementar automáticamente los cambios en los temas de WordPress mediante GitHub

Si eres un desarrollador trabajando en un tema personalizado, también es posible desplegar automáticamente tus cambios en GitHub.

Esto puede ahorrarte mucho tiempo y también te asegura que tienes diferentes versiones de tu tema guardadas en caso de que necesites deshacer cambios en el futuro.

Para más detalles sobre cómo hacerlo, puedes consultar nuestra guía sobre cómo desplegar automáticamente los cambios en los temas de WordPress utilizando GitHub y Deploy.

Esperamos que esta guía te haya ayudado a instalar plugins o temas de WordPress desde GitHub. También puedes consultar nuestra guía sobre cómo programar un sitio web y nuestra selección de los mejores fragmentos de código para WordPress.

If you liked this article, then please subscribe to our YouTube Channel for WordPress video tutorials. You can also find us on Twitter and Facebook.

Descargo: Nuestro contenido está apoyado por los lectores. Esto significa que si hace clic en algunos de nuestros enlaces, podemos ganar una comisión. Vea cómo se financia WPBeginner , por qué es importante, y cómo puede apoyarnos. Aquí está nuestro proceso editorial .

Avatar

Editorial Staff at WPBeginner is a team of WordPress experts led by Syed Balkhi with over 16 years of experience in WordPress, Web Hosting, eCommerce, SEO, and Marketing. Started in 2009, WPBeginner is now the largest free WordPress resource site in the industry and is often referred to as the Wikipedia for WordPress.

El último kit de herramientas de WordPress

Obtenga acceso GRATUITO a nuestro kit de herramientas - una colección de productos y recursos relacionados con WordPress que todo profesional debería tener!

Reader Interactions

16 comentariosDeja una respuesta

  1. Ethan

    Hi, are the plugins and themes from github safe to download without malware and other malicious code?

    • WPBeginner Support

      It would depend on who’s code you are downloading

      Administrador

  2. Ismail

    Hello admin,

    Thank you so much for this article and I learn a lot from this site. Today, I want to download Facebook Instant Articles fro Github, and this article help me to do that. But I have a question, if possible please guide me since I am newbie.

    For FBIA plugin from WP Directory, do I have to uninstall it and install the plugin from Github afterwards? I hope you can help me on this. Thank you for your help to all people.

    • WPBeginner Support

      If you are replacing the plugin with a version from GitHub it would normally be best to remove the old files and then replace them with the plugin from GitHub

      Administrador

  3. yh

    wordpress is saying I need a business plan to add plug ins. is there any way around this? or is there any way for me to retrieve a scheduled post and post it manually? I cant find the post anywhere

  4. Andy Fragen

    Thanks for mentioning GitHub Updater. It works with plugins or themes hosted on GitHub, Bitbucket or GitLab.

    As a bonus you can use GitHub Updater to perform a one click install of any GitHub, BitBucket, or GitLab (public or private repos) plugins or themes using only the repository URI vastly simplifying the instructions in the article.

  5. adolf witzeling

    GitHub is great-for learning too. I’ve gained so much knowledge just by looking at code from github. Thanks for this nice post!

  6. Gautam Doddamani

    GitHub and StackOverflow are some of my favourite sites for checking out useful scripts that i can use on my blog. I am using one plugin from GtiHub myself…but didn’t know about the GitHub updater…thanks guys!

  7. Morgan

    Here is a real tip:

    Right click “Download ZIP” > Copy Link Address

    Plugins > Add New > Upload > Choose File

    When the window pops-up for you to find your zip file, just paste the URL and it will fetch the link. No need to clutter your computer with files you don’t need.

    • Andy Fragen

      You can actually do a one click install using the Remote Install feature of GitHub Updater. Added benefit is the plugin/theme directory is correctly renamed.

  8. Tracy

    Are the plugins found on Github any more “unsafe” than the plugins that are in the repository?

    • WPBeginner Support

      Tracy, yes there is a chance of that. In the WordPress plugin repository, plugins go through a basic review process and since it is a larger community an unsafe plugin would get caught much quicker than on GitHub.

      Administrador

  9. Aaron

    Awesome article, I heard your interview on Mixergy. Really love how you use FAQ’s to drive content. I had no idea your traffic was so huge- very cool to see your growth through value creation. Congrats! –Aaron

  10. Alfred Degens

    Thanks for this article!

    Can you tell me where to find Wordpress plugins on GitHub?
    Is there a way to search for those open source plugins on Github?
    I tried on Google search but didn’t find any plugin on Github.

    Regards,
    Alfred

Deja tu comentario

Gracias por elegir dejar un comentario. Tenga en cuenta que todos los comentarios son moderados de acuerdo con nuestros política de comentarios, y su dirección de correo electrónico NO será publicada. Por favor, NO utilice palabras clave en el campo de nombre. Tengamos una conversación personal y significativa.